1st Scholarship Dance with D.J. music at the Community Center

Por Herman Santa

On Saturday, May 18, 1996, the members of the “Spanish American Club, Inc.” from Martin and St. Lucie counties celebrated the first “Scholarship Dance” at the Community Center in Port St. Lucie. The dance was enlivened by the great “Dou Riviera” from Port St. Lucie and by the club’s D.J.s (Herman, Juan Carlos, and Cesar). The funds raised will be exclusively for the scholarship we donate to a Latino student to help them attend college. Thanks to Duo Riviera, the club’s D.J.s, the scholarship committee, the directors of the club, and those who made donations.
